using System;
using System.Diagnostics;
using System.Collections.Generic;
using System.Threading;
using System.Threading.Tasks;
namespace ET
{
public static class ShellHelper
{
private static string shellApp
{
get
{
#if UNITY_EDITOR_WIN
string app = "cmd.exe";
#elif UNITY_EDITOR_OSX
string app = "bash";
#endif
return app;
}
}
private static volatile bool isFinish;
public static void Run(string cmd, string workDirectory, List<string> environmentVars = null)
{
Process p = null;
try
{
ProcessStartInfo start = new ProcessStartInfo(shellApp);
#if UNITY_EDITOR_OSX
string splitChar = ":";
start.Arguments = "-c";
#elif UNITY_EDITOR_WIN
string splitChar = ";";
start.Arguments = "/c";
#endif
if (environmentVars != null)
{
foreach (string var in environmentVars)
{
start.EnvironmentVariables["PATH"] += (splitChar + var);
}
}
start.Arguments += (" \"" + cmd + "\"");
start.CreateNoWindow = true;
start.ErrorDialog = true;
start.UseShellExecute = false;
start.WorkingDirectory = workDirectory;
if (start.UseShellExecute)
{
start.RedirectStandardOutput = false;
start.RedirectStandardError = false;
start.RedirectStandardInput = false;
}
else
{
start.RedirectStandardOutput = true;
start.RedirectStandardError = true;
start.RedirectStandardInput = true;
start.StandardOutputEncoding = System.Text.Encoding.UTF8;
start.StandardErrorEncoding = System.Text.Encoding.UTF8;
}
Barrier barrier = new Barrier(2);
// 放到新线程启动进程,主线程循环读标准输出,直到进程结束
Task.Run(() =>
{
p = Process.Start(start);
barrier.RemoveParticipant();
p.WaitForExit();
isFinish = true;
});
// 这里要等待进程启动才能往下走,否则p将为null
barrier.SignalAndWait();
do
{
string line = p.StandardOutput.ReadLine();
if (string.IsNullOrEmpty(line))
{
break;
}
line = line.Replace("\\", "/");
UnityEngine.Debug.Log(line);
}
while (!isFinish);
bool hasError = false;
while (true)
{
string error = p.StandardError.ReadLine();
if (string.IsNullOrEmpty(error))
{
break;
}
hasError = true;
UnityEngine.Debug.LogError(error);
}
p.Close();
if (hasError)
{
UnityEngine.Debug.LogError("has error!");
}
}
catch (Exception e)
{
UnityEngine.Debug.LogException(e);
if (p != null)
{
p.Close();
}
}
}
}
}
